Configuration LaTeX dans le Cloud

Pour partager sa configuration LaTeX entre plusieurs ordinateurs il est possible de déplacer le dossier texmf contenant les personnalisations vers un dossier synchronisé dans le « Cloud », avec « Copy« , « DropBox » ou autre « Service Cloud ».

Le chemin de ce dossier sera de la forme :
`/Users/marc/Cloud/latex/texmf/tex/` et il doit être organisé avec un arbre TeX pour être reconnu à la compilation (Dossiers tex, latex, bibtex/bst et bibtex/bib ).

Pour qu’il soit reconnu par LaTeX il suffit d’éditer le fichier: `/usr/local/texlive/2016/texmf.cnf` pour le désigner à la variable `TEXMFHOME`.

Cela donne:

% (Public domain.)
% This texmf.cnf file should contain only your personal changes from the
% original texmf.cnf (for example, as chosen in the installer).
%
% That is, if you need to make changes to texmf.cnf, put your custom
% settings in this file, which is …/texlive/YYYY/texmf.cnf, rather than
% the distributed file (which is …/texlive/YYYY/texmf-dist/web2c/texmf.cnf).
% And include *only* your changed values, not a copy of the whole thing!
%
TEXMFHOME = ~/Cloud/latex/texmf
TEXMFVAR = ~/Library/texlive/2013/texmf-var
TEXMFCONFIG = ~/Library/texlive/2013/texmf-config

Vous pouvez vérifier que la variable est bien prise en compte avec la commande:

kpsewhich -var-value TEXMFHOME

ou encore plus généralement:

texconfig conf

Une autre façon de faire, plus simple est d’utiliser la commande :

sudo tlmgr conf texmf TEXMFHOME « /Users/marc/Cloud/latex/texmf/tex/ »

Leave Comment

Votre adresse de messagerie ne sera pas publiée. Les champs obligatoires sont indiqués avec *